optical fiber tube

简明释义

光导纤维管

英英释义

A cylindrical structure made of transparent materials, designed to transmit light signals for telecommunications and data communication.

一种由透明材料制成的圆柱形结构,旨在传输光信号用于电信和数据通信。

In today's rapidly advancing technological world, the importance of communication cannot be overstated. One of the most significant advancements in this field has been the development of the optical fiber tube (光纤管). This remarkable invention has revolutionized the way we transmit data and communicate over long distances. Unlike traditional copper wires, which are limited by their ability to carry signals, an optical fiber tube uses light to transmit information, allowing for faster and more reliable communication.The basic principle behind an optical fiber tube is relatively simple. It consists of a core made of glass or plastic that is surrounded by a cladding layer, which has a lower refractive index. When light is transmitted through the core, it reflects off the cladding, allowing the light to travel long distances without significant loss of signal. This technology has enabled internet service providers to offer high-speed internet connections, which have become essential in our daily lives.Moreover, the durability and flexibility of an optical fiber tube make it an ideal choice for various applications. They are not only used in telecommunications but also in medical instruments, industrial applications, and even in decorative lighting. The ability to transmit data over long distances with minimal interference has made optical fibers indispensable in modern technology.As we continue to rely on the internet for everything from work to social interactions, the role of the optical fiber tube will only become more prominent. With the ever-increasing demand for bandwidth, engineers and scientists are constantly working to improve the efficiency and capacity of these tubes. Innovations such as multi-core fibers and photonic crystal fibers are just a few examples of how this technology is evolving.However, the widespread adoption of optical fiber tubes is not without its challenges. The installation process can be complex and costly, requiring specialized knowledge and equipment. Additionally, while optical fibers are less susceptible to electromagnetic interference compared to copper cables, they can still be affected by physical damage and environmental factors. Therefore, ongoing research is necessary to address these issues and enhance the reliability of optical fiber technology.In conclusion, the optical fiber tube (光纤管) represents a significant leap forward in communication technology. Its ability to transmit data at high speeds and over long distances has transformed the way we connect with one another. As technology continues to evolve, the importance of optical fibers will only grow, paving the way for even more advanced communication systems in the future. Understanding and utilizing this technology is crucial as we navigate the digital age, making the optical fiber tube an essential component of modern life.
